that Crystal Store for example I didn’t even know what winning looked like so one problem with an experiment it’s easy to use this word experiment but the way a science experiment works you have a hypothesis you’re like I believe this then you run the test and it either confirms it or it doesn’t yeah but I was using the word experiment wrong which was like I’m just going to try a bunch of [  ] without actually knowing like what is the win condition yeah what is the success or failure condition of this and so like now that I look now that I actually have an e-commerce like our e-commerce business now you know is is doing very well it’s a 8 figure e-commerce business now that I know what an e-com is looks like I can go back and think about our our Crystal Store actually was doing very well like I just didn’t know so for example we were running Facebook ads and the key metric for all e-commerce businesses is your row ad your return on ad Spin and I think we were getting like 1.7 yeah well like the Rocks we were selling these rocks for like 50 60 they call they’re CST yeah CST and yeah no I remember like like the first few hours we got that that Shopify ding amazing like that was I mean most people start up a store and they don’t have sales for like a couple of days or whatever or weeks and so yeah it I think out problem was like just didn’t continue we didn’t continue exactly cuz now that I look back it was like 1.7 to 2X and I remember thinking oh it’s supposed to be 3 or 4X I think cuz I had heard some idiot saying that somewhere and I just thought that’s what it is and so I was like H I guess this is bad turn it like shut it down let’s do the next thing uh you know in retrospect I you know maybe I’m glad I’m not running a crystal store but at the same time like there is a lesson there of I mean sticking to it is obviously a c like you can’t win without the stick to itness but one of the things that makes you stick to it is not just willpower it’s like knowing your win condition so like you do you even know what to look at and do you know what winning looks like do you know what the Benchmark should be so that you can actually assess a successful versus unsuccessful experiment that’s one of my learning one of my things I remember from back then the other one I remember is like with the Pod I we kind of like we called our shot a little bit like article and a few days later a billionaire read that article and then we’ll tell that story a sec so even that is like um there’s this phrase that I read once I think Mark sster did a blog post about this called lines not dots basically the idea is like a line is just a collection of dots like right mathematically that’s what a line is it’s multiple dots just all all connected and so what he says is like you know in he’s like what people think happens is they see on tv that you go in you meet this investor cold you blow their socks off with this pitch and then they write you this check and say you know here you go son go go on and it’s like that’s not what happens like that’s movies that’s Shark Tank that’s not real and the real thing is dots and so he’s like you know many interactions that stack up that when you look back later is a line um and he’s like investors invest in lines not dots meaning they’re not just going to like it’s not the very first interaction typically where it’s all just going to happen for you and so it’s following the person liking the post replying to something they notice that this person said something smart not the first time but the third time yeah then after that they follow you back and then because of that they see this other blun post you wrote you don’t even realize that one of your 98 views was this person who’s actually legit and then go you know like and then so those dots Stack Up and ultimately that’s how trust gets built that’s how this the framework this is the the framea king yeah actually watch me cuss baby this is what I do uh
